A meter scale is moving with uniform velocity. This impliesAThe force acting on the scale is zero, but a torque about the centre of mass can act on the scale.BThe force acting on the scale is zero and the net torque acting about the centre of mass of the scale is also zero.CThe total force acting on it need not be zero but the torque on it is zero.DNeither force nor the torque needs to be zero.
Solution
The correct answer is B. The force acting on the scale is zero and the net torque acting about the centre of mass of the scale is also zero.
Here's why:
-
Newton's first law of motion states that an object will remain at rest or move in a straight line at a constant speed unless acted upon by an external force. So, if the meter scale is moving with a uniform velocity, it means there is no net external force acting on it. Hence, the force acting on the scale is zero.
-
Torque is a measure of how much a force acting on an object causes that object to rotate. The object will continue to rotate at a constant angular velocity unless a net torque is acting on it. Since the meter scale is not accelerating or decelerating, but moving at a uniform velocity, it implies that there is no net torque acting on it. Hence, the net torque acting about the centre of mass of the scale is also zero.
